Jot Tior - Hilli, Dakshin Dinajpur

Jot Tior is a village situated in the Hilli subdivision of Dakshin Dinajpur district, West Bengal. It is located approximately 10.8 km from the tehsil headquarters in Hilli and around 13.2 km from the district headquarters in Balurghat. Binshira serves as the Gram Panchayat for Jot Tior village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Jot Tior is 311043. The village covers a total geographical area of 113.26 hectares and falls under the 733145 pincode. Balurghat is the nearest town, located about 11 km away.

Jot Tior village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Jot Tior

As per Census 2011, Jot Tior village has a total population of 882 people, consisting of 444 males and 438 females. The village has 224 households and a sex ratio of 986 females per 1,000 males. There are 65 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 728 literate and 154 illiterate residents. Additionally, 47 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 143 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
